What is an entry level mathematician?

An Entry Level Mathematician applies mathematical principles and techniques to solve problems in business, science, engineering, and other fields. They analyze data, develop models, and use statistical or computational methods to support decision-making. Entry-level roles may involve working with algorithms, simulations, or predictive analytics. These positions are commonly found in industries like finance, government, research, and technology. Strong analytical skills, problem-solving abilities, and proficiency in mathematical software are often required.

What does an entry level mathematician do?

A typical day for an Entry Level Mathematician often involves analyzing datasets, developing mathematical models, and preparing reports or visualizations to present findings. You might collaborate closely with engineers, data scientists, or business analysts to solve specific problems or optimize processes. While some tasks are independent, many projects are team-based and require regular meetings to update progress and brainstorm solutions. You can also expect time set aside for learning new software or mathematical techniques relevant to your organization's needs. Overall, the role offers a balance of independent research and collaborative problem-solving, providing valuable experience early in your career.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level mathematician?

To thrive as an Entry Level Mathematician, you need strong analytical and problem-solving skills, a solid understanding of mathematical theories, and a bachelor's degree in mathematics or a related field. Familiarity with statistical software (such as R or SAS), programming languages like Python or MATLAB, and data analysis tools is often required. Excellent communication, teamwork, and time management skills distinguish top candidates in this role. These capabilities enable mathematicians to interpret complex data, coll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, and deliver clear, actionable solutions to real-world problems.
